W. E. Dever, known to virtually everyone as “Dub,” was born Oct. 29 1936 in Snyder, TX, to the home of Una Lee (McGinty) and Marvin Elijah Dever, and passed from this life in Portales on May 7, 2026.  The Dever family moved to Roosevelt County in 1941.  He was a 1954 graduate of Portales High School, and shortly after on June 7, 1954 he was married to Jeanette Kerr.  The couple was able to celebrate 71 years of marriage before his death.

For most of his adult life, Dub drove trucks.  Through the years he had driven for Southwest Canners, Kenneth Cook, Jack Jennings, and Rick Ledbetter among others.  He was a member of the University Baptist Church.  Mr. Dever was extremely friendly and virtually never met a stranger.  Dub loved children, and his grandsons and great-grandchildren were the pride and joy of his life.  Above all else he enjoyed his times hunting and fishing with them.  In more recent years he got great satisfaction from eliminating squirrels from his yard.  Ingeniously, he could tell if one returned, because he would often trap them and paint their tails white before releasing them in a remote area.
